    The biggest problem with this Titans team.

    They're not that great of a damn team.

    Talk about giving the Texans false hope? [stupid joke]False hope should be the name of our starting safety. It almost is. Lol [/stupid joke]

    We got all super hopped up after three wins. One big one to a good Baltimore team. Then to Cleveland.... Then to Denver. And people on this board are shouting PLAYOFFS! SUPERBOWL!! HASSELBECK FOR MVP!!! WOOOH!! Lol. No.

    We had one big upset and won two games any half way decent team should have won.

    We're a rebuilding team. Rebuilding teams have a lot of problems, but it can all be categorized under the field called "Lack of talent".

    If you want to pinpoint the biggest ones (in no particular order, because they're all pretty big).

    1.) Our center shouldn't even be starting in the CFL

    2.) So should 75% of the defensive line. I'll give exception to JJ, Klug, Morgan, and Smith. Problem is Klug's a mid-round rookie. Smith's a weirdo that attracts flags like a gay pride parade. Morgan's always hurt, and JJ's playing out of position and is always hurt.

    3.) Our two best players on offense are MIA. Kenny Britt with an injury, and CJ with a sudden onset of being a horrible running back.

    4.) Idk why but I paid attention to Griffin today. He gave up some touchdowns, looked slow. Seems to have lost his edge. Oh and our other safety is a 50 year old career backup.

    5.) Ruud was a bad pickup.

    6.) A lot of the good young players we have are just that, good and young. I don't jump on Cook or Williams or Harper (if we'd ever freaking playt he guy) or Locker (when we eventually do freaking play the guy) for their mistakes. When they start making mistakes later in their career I'll be upset. This is the time for mistakes.

    7.) Some bad playcalling (especially on defense).

    8.) Matt Hasselbeck's a good QB. He's not Jesus like some people on this board seem to want him to be. I don't think he should be around next year, I don't see him leading this team to anything bigger than maybe the first round of the playoffs. If he's willing to stay and be a mentor/insurance to Locker, than GREAT. If not... I'd rather move on.

    Everything on that list can be categorized under: "We just don't have the right group of players on the field together. When the McNair/Fisher era ended, we haven't been right since. Last year we lost a head coach and a starting QB (not b!+ching about either of them leaving, it was time for both) as well as a lot of other key players. Especially on defense. It's pretty ballsy to think that Tennessee's going to take the field and make a huge run under those circumstances. If we end up 8-8 I'd say that's going above the expectations for most teams in the situation we're in.

    Basically our problem isn't really a problem. We're just a transitioning team, not a superbowl contender. Hell we wouldn't even be a playoff contender if Peyton Manning didn't get hurt. Some fans and coaches don't want to accept that reality.
